UML leaders did not understand the law: CEC Yadav

Chief Election Commissioner Ayodhee Prasad Yadav speaks with journalists in Kathmandu, on Sunday, December 31, 2017.

Kathmandu, December 31

Chief Election Commissioner Ayodhee Prasad Yadav says accusations made by some CPN-UML leaders that the Election Commission was delaying the new government formation by putting on hold final results of proportional representation elections for House of Representatives are meaningless.

He says the leaders making such charges have not understood the law about the process of result announcement.

“If they feel our role is suspicious, it is their issue; please ask with themselves,” Yadav told journalists while speaking at an interaction in Kathmandu today.

Yadav reiterated that the PR poll results could be announced only after the conclusion of National Assembly elections as each party should allocate 33 per cent of their total lawmakers to women and the missing portion should be fulfilled through PR elections for House of Representatives.

He said the Commission would announce all results within 30 days of the conclusion of National Assembly polls.

In another context, Yadav said the Commission would take action if any party was found to have altered the order of its PR candidates while making the selection.
